Do Jiangsu and Subei belong to Jiangnan?
But culturally, parts of Nantong in northern Jiangsu belong to Jiangnan cultural circle.
The situation in northern Jiangsu is very complicated (it is the most complicated because it is in the cultural conflict zone between North and South):
Xuzhou, Lianyungang, Suqian and parts of Yancheng (Xiangshui, Binhai, Funing, Yancheng, Jianhu, Du Yan, Sheyang and north of Longgang River in Dafeng) belong to the northern cultural circle.
Parts of Yangzhou, Huai 'an, Taizhou, Nantong (Rugao, Hai 'an and Rudong) and Yancheng (Dafeng and Dongtai) belong to the Jianghuai cultural circle. In addition, parts of Nanjing and Zhenjiang in the south of the Yangtze River (some towns in Jurong and Danyang) also belong to the Jianghuai cultural circle.
Tongzhou, Nantong, Haimen, Qidong and Rudong in Nantong, northern Jiangsu, and some coastal towns in Sheyang, Yancheng (Daxing and Linhai are mainly immigrants from Changzhou in ancient Jiangnan) all belong to Jiangnan cultural circle.
